Abstract

Indonesia is known for its rich diversity, encompassing ethnicity, religion, culture, customs, and traditional artifacts, including traditional weapons. Traditional weapons hold significant historical and cultural value in Indonesia. To preserve and represent knowledge about these traditional weapons, an ontology model is essential. Ontology serves as a knowledge base that can effectively capture and represent information. In this project, we developed an ontology model for traditional weapons in Indonesia using the Protégé ontology development tool. The METHONTOLOGY method guided the step-by-step development of the ontology model, providing detailed descriptions for each stage. The ontology model consists of 6 classes, 4 object properties, 1 data property, and 72 individuals. We conducted testing of the ontology model through SPARQL queries. By building this ontology model, our aim is to contribute to the preservation and documentation of Indonesia's cultural heritage related to traditional weapons. The ontology serves as a valuable resource for researchers, enthusiasts, and institutions interested in studying and promoting traditional weapons in Indonesia. Abstract

This research aims to implement a Convolutional Neural Network (CNN) in facial expression classification using the Kaggle dataset which consists of five types of facial expressions, namely anger, disgust, fear, happiness and sadness. This method is considered important in supporting various applications such as emotion detection, facial recognition, and better human-machine communication. In this research, data preprocessing and augmentation were carried out using ImageDataGenerator to increase data diversity and prevent overfitting. Next, a CNN architecture is built which consists of convolution layers, pooling layers, and Dense layers. The model was trained using the Adam optimizer with a categorical crossentropy loss function for 50 epochs. The results show that the model achieves approximately 51% accuracy on the validation set. However, further analysis showed variations in model performance among facial expression classes, with some classes performing better than others. Abstract

“Garbage in, garbage out” merupakan sebuah ungkapan klasik dalam data science yang menyatakan bahwa kualitas keluaran suatu sistem bergantung pada kualitas data yang dimasukkan. Dalam klasifikasi sentimen, negasi memainkan peran penting dalam menentukan polaritas sentimen kalimat, tetapi sering kali dihapus pada tahap preprocessing sebagai stopword, yang dapat menghilangkan konteks negasi tersebut. Penelitian ini mengevaluasi dampak dua teknik penanganan negasi Next Word Negation dan penggantian antonim terhadap performa Naïve Bayes Classifier dan Support Vector Machine Classifier. Teknik Next Word Negation menggabungkan kata penanda negasi dengan kata setelahnya seperti “tidak cepat” menjadi “tidak_cepat”. Sementara itu, teknik penggantian antonim mengganti kata penanda negasi dan kata setelahnya dengan antonim dari kata setelahnya, misalnya “tidak cepat” menjadi “lambat”. Hasil penelitian menunjukkan bahwa teknik penanganan negasi meningkatkan akurasi Naïve Bayes dari 82,94% tanpa penanganan negasi menjadi 85,88% dengan Next Word Negation dan 87,64% dengan penggantian antonim. Untuk Support Vector Machine, akurasi meningkat dari 84,70% tanpa penanganan negasi menjadi 89,41% dengan penggantian antonim dan 88,23% dengan Next Word Negation. Abstract “Garbage in, garbage out” is a classic expression in data science that states the quality of a system’s output depends on the quality of the input data. In sentiment classification, negation plays a crucial role in determining the sentiment polarity of a sentence but is often removed during the preprocessing stage as a stopword, potentially eliminating the context of negation. This study evaluates the impact of two negation-handling techniques, Next Word Negation and antonym replacement, on the performance of Naïve Bayes Classifier and Support Vector Machine Classifier. The Next Word Negation technique combines the negation marker with the following word, for example, “tidak cepat” becomes “tidak_cepat”. Meanwhile, the antonym replacement technique replaces the negation marker and the following word with the antonym of the following word, for example, “tidak cepat” becomes “lambat”. The results of the study show that negation-handling techniques improve the accuracy of Naïve Bayes from 82.94% without negation handling to 85.88% with Next Word Negation and 87.64% with antonym replacement. For the Support Vector Machine, accuracy increases from 84.70% without negation handling to 89.41% with antonym replacement and 88.23% with Next Word Negation.
